Edgebanding Made Easy: The Art of Lacquering207
As a leading manufacturer of edgebanding in China, we understand the importance of high-quality, durable finishes for furniture. Lacquering is a traditional technique that has been used for centuries to protect and beautify wooden surfaces, and it remains a popular choice for contemporary furniture makers.
Edgebanding plays a crucial role in the overall aesthetics and longevity of furniture. It protects the exposed edges of panels from moisture, wear, and tear, preventing warping and delamination. By applying a lacquer finish to the edgebanding, you can further enhance its protective properties and create a smooth, seamless appearance that complements the wood grain.
Benefits of Lacquered Edgebanding
Enhanced durability: Lacquer forms a hard, protective coating that resists scratches, dents, and other forms of damage, ensuring that your furniture looks its best for years to come.
Moisture resistance: Lacquer is water-resistant, protecting the edges of your furniture from moisture penetration that can cause warping or delamination.
Chemical resistance: Lacquer is resistant to common household chemicals, such as cleaners and detergents, making it easy to maintain your furniture without damaging the finish.
Aesthetic appeal: Lacquered edgebanding creates a smooth, polished look that complements the natural beauty of wood. It can be customized to match any color or sheen level, allowing you to achieve the desired aesthetic for your furniture.
Process of Lacquering Edgebanding
The process of lacquering edgebanding is relatively straightforward, but it requires careful attention to detail to achieve the best results. Here is a step-by-step guide:
Prepare the edgebanding: Ensure that the edgebanding is clean and free of any dust or debris. Sand it lightly to create a smooth surface for the lacquer to adhere to.
Apply the first coat of lacquer: Use a high-quality lacquer that is specifically designed for edgebanding. Apply a thin, even coat using a brush or spray gun. Allow the lacquer to dry completely before proceeding.
Sand the first coat: Once the first coat of lacquer is dry, sand it lightly to remove any imperfections. This will help to create a smooth surface for the subsequent coats.
Apply additional coats of lacquer: Apply two or three additional coats of lacquer, sanding lightly between each coat. This will build up the thickness and durability of the finish.
Buff the finish: Once the final coat of lacquer is dry, buff it with a soft cloth to remove any surface imperfections and bring out the shine.
Tips for Lacquering Edgebanding
Use high-quality lacquer: The quality of the lacquer you use will have a significant impact on the durability and appearance of the finish. Choose a lacquer that is specifically designed for edgebanding and is resistant to moisture, chemicals, and scratches.
Apply thin, even coats: Avoid applying thick coats of lacquer, as this can lead to runs and drips. Apply thin, even coats and allow each coat to dry completely before proceeding.
Sand between coats: Sanding between coats is essential to create a smooth, durable finish. Use a fine-grit sandpaper and sand lightly to remove any imperfections.
Buff the finish: Buffing the finish will bring out the shine and remove any surface imperfections. Use a soft cloth and buff in a circular motion until the desired shine is achieved.
Conclusion
Lacquered edgebanding is an excellent way to protect and beautify the edges of your furniture. By following the steps outlined above, you can achieve a high-quality, durable finish that will extend the life of your furniture and enhance its aesthetics.
